Description

Describe the bug
When we open a restaurant details card and click on its info icon all of its necessary details will open up and at the bottom of screen there is written Restaurant none and Website none so either allow user on admin dashboard store profile to enter the restaurant name field and its website field or there should be no such headings.

To Re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. Go to 'Enatega Customer Application'
  2. Click on 'Restaurant card details'
  3. now click on the top right corner Info icon , restaurant details will open up see at the bottom of screen the two headings Restaurant and Website.

Expected behavior
so either allow user on admin dashboard store profile to enter the restaurant name field and its website field or there should be no such headings.
